I keep forgetting the Americans' strange timing system so Soho has actually rated/run 1.48.4 in our language

I have rarely watched any US racing, I can't get excited about 1 mile single file stuff but watching the replay and reading the times for that race, it was amazing to see her as leader most of the way still finishing off with a Q of 25.4 (Aussie timing)
She left here as a top 4yo who raced in all the Gp races and now as a 6yo is probably much stronger but finishing off races that fast - I guess a 55.6 (Aus) first half is called stacking them up over there (Always B Miki's WR 1.46 was run 52.4/53.6)

I know the track is 200m bigger than Menangle but I think her fastest time over here would have been her 7m 4th in the 2019 Ladyship Mile where she was 1x1 all the way and pretty much stayed the same distance behind leader and winner Dream About Me who ran 1.50.1 coming home in 26.6, so Soho would have been < 1.51 that night

My calculations tell me that every runner bar last in R7 at Stawell today broke the Track Record (and last just missed by less than a metre)
The winner and new record holder Roquefort Cheese took 2.07.8 for the 1785m (and rated 1.55.2)
That equates to 13.97m per second (very close to 7m per half second)
6th was only beaten 6.7m (< half a second behind) and the old record was 0.5 seconds slower MR of 1.55.7

I could add that at the point that Roquefort Cheese hit the line, last place had rated 1.55.7 (the old record) for 7.7m short of the full distance - and most probably maintained that MR for his last 7.7m to cross the line

Anyway Roquefort Cheese took a massive 0.5 seconds off the previous best Tk Record / Mile Rate

Whiskey Cavalier won first up in a metro race at Melton 4 weeks after hopping on a plane in NZ. Rangiora (Canterbury) trained, had won 4 of 17, importantly his last at start 15 in 1.57.5 over 1980 at Addington. Sale assured, as an R62 rating. Consistent since running mile rates at least a second quicker, as all our tracks are.

Outlaw Man won only 4 of 27 for the highly regarded Cambridge trainer, Arna Donnelly.

Fronts up and wins at Melton just 21 days (! - are you there, PP?) After being cleared mid-November, not having won since April. Only rated R55 in NZ, so an easy to place horse amongst camels in Victoria. Another Sweet Lou, so plenty of speed but stamina optional. Wins 8 from 13 here, yet to be tested beyond 2240m.

These horses always get to race well within their class in Victoria, unlike NZ. I watched the Group 3 FFA from Addington last Friday, 8 starters over 1980m. Krug, 20 wis from 50 starts, multiple Gp 1 wins and nearly $700k banked. Barriers 1 & 2 a pair of 4yo's, Lumen Caellli, 4 wins from 11 starts. Next to him, Bollinger 5 from 16 but 100 grand earnt. Krug, who is at his nut case worst, slingshots out of the gate, looked unbeatable half way down the back, then called it a day as Bollinger raced to the lead halfway around the turn, bolts in.
For that effort, he is now an R72, 10 points more than Whiskey Cavalier was from the same number of race starts. Would Whiskey Cavalier have won like Bollinger did? No way known. But he can be placed to advantage in Australia. Bollinger is likely to run in a $45k FFA over 2600m Saturday night. While that is another big ask, at least his star stablemate Akuta is competing on the North Island!

That highlights another reason why so many Kiwis end over here, no 4yo Sires Stake scheme, very few feature 4 yo races and mares - forget it. Sold if they're good enough or bred from if they've earned enough to be commercial.

But none of them can rationally impove "naturally" like Bettorzippit.
